MLB 09: The Show for PSP offers an immersive baseball experience with a mix of innovative features and attention to detail that will surely please retro gaming enthusiasts. The game introduces Road to the Show 3.0, which includes interactive training, new settings, a steal/lead-off system, presentations, and coach interactions. The interactive training feature offers a series of mini-games designed to improve the player’s abilities in various aspects of baseball, adding a layer of skill development and strategy to the gameplay.
Another notable improvement is found in Franchise Mode 2.0, which finally includes the long-awaited 40-man roster. Additionally, this mode introduces Salary Arbitration, Waiver Transactions, and September call-ups, adding depth and realism to the overall franchise experience. These enhancements make managing a team more engaging and strategic.
The inclusion of Training/Practice Drills provides players with the opportunity to fine-tune their baseball skills in various game situations. These drills offer a perfect way to polish one’s abilities and improve gameplay performance.
What sets MLB 09: The Show apart is its dedication to the details and subtleties that make the game feel authentic and immersive. The realistic stadiums and signage, wear and tear on the field, dusk to night lighting transitions, stadium Jumbotron animations, and even crowd atmosphere all contribute to the suspension of disbelief. The crowd’s behavior, such as reaching up for foul balls and home runs, along with crowd rivalries and weather-appropriate clothing, adds to the overall atmosphere of the game.
